Care Roadshow Glasgow will be coming to Hampden Park Stadium on 5 March, hosting seminars and workshops from many experts within the care sector.
Care home owners, managers and those involved in the care industry will be able to take advantage of this environment to network and share connections.
As well as this they will benefit from demonstrations of the latest products and services available from a broad range of exhibitors.
Throughout the day visitors will be able to go to educational seminars led by care industry experts. These seminars will cover a broad selection of issues and be free to attend.
Ranald Mair, chief executive of Scottish care will explore the current developments, challenges and issues facing the care home sector in Scotland. A late morning seminar from Lee Sheppard, the divisional manager of care homes for Apetito, will discuss nutrition and dignity. Talks in the afternoon will cover topics surrounding dementia and workforce leadership development.
Exercise therapy specialists Oomph will be at the event promoting the benefits of regular exercise for people suffering from dementia, arthritis, depression, and osteoporosis. They will be discussing how their chair based exercises ‘Cheerobics’ and ‘Strictly Fun Dancing’ can be beneficial.
As well as keeping up to date with the latest news in the industry, the event will encourage people to create ideas that will improve their own care setting and community.
